Kanzen Co., Ltd. will publish "The World's Easiest Whisky Taste Guide" on December 6th. The book describes the taste of "138 bottles x 3 (drinking methods)" in straightforward terms using "taste icons," written by an otaku who has enjoyed approximately 300 brands of whiskey.
The taste of "138 Bottles x 3 (Straight, Rocks, Highball)" is expressed in straightforward words!
Led by Yamazaki, a Japanese whiskey whose price continues to soar due to its global popularity, drinking whiskey itself is becoming a supreme pleasure. Yet, the reason people still reach for whiskey is likely due to the complex, profound flavor it offers that other alcoholic beverages lack. By using your own vocabulary to describe this complex, profound flavor without drowning in pretentious words, you can enjoy whiskey even more. This book is the world's easiest-to-understand whiskey encyclopedia to date, written by an otaku who has enjoyed approximately 300 brands of whiskey, from high-end bottles to popular bottles, and drinking styles (straight, on the rocks, highball), and describes the taste of "138 bottles x 3 (drinking styles)" in straightforward terms using "taste icons."

Book information
Book title: "The World's Easiest Whisky Taste Guide" ISBN: 978-4-86255-742-1 Author: Asakura Asage Illustration: omiso Number of pages: 296 Format: A5 size Price: 2,090 yen (1,900 yen + tax) Release date: December 6, 2024 Publisher: Kanzen Product URL:https://www.kanzen.jp/book/b10107002.html
